E. H. Gombrich was a prominent art historian and theorist known for his influential works in the field of art history. Born in Vienna in 1909, he was exposed to a rich cultural environment that shaped his understanding and appreciation of art. Gombrich's career spanned several decades, during which he published numerous books and essays that explore the nature of art and its interpretation. One of his most significant contributions is 'The Story of Art', a comprehensive survey that remains a staple in art education.

His writings, including 'Meditations on a Hobby Horse', delve into the philosophical aspects of art, emphasizing the importance of perception in understanding visual culture. Gombrich advocated for a contextual approach to art, arguing that the meaning of an artwork is inherently tied to its historical and cultural background. His insights have influenced generations of scholars, making him a vital figure in the study of art history. Gombrich's legacy continues to inspire both artists and academics alike.
